Description

Brave CMS is an open-source CMS. Prior to 2.0.6, an Unrestricted File Upload vulnerability in the CKEditor endpoint allows attackers to upload arbitrary files, including executable scripts. This may lead to Remote Code Execution (RCE) on the server, potentially resulting in full system compromise, data exfiltration, or service disruption. All users running affected versions of BraveCMS are impacted. This vulnerability is fixed in 2.0.6.

Analysis

Unrestricted file upload in BraveCMS 2.0 (prior to 2.0.6) enables remote attackers to execute arbitrary code on the server without authentication. The CKEditor endpoint accepts malicious file uploads including executable scripts, leading to full remote code execution with CVSS 9.3 severity. …

Remediation

Within 24 hours: Inventory all BraveCMS deployments and confirm versions; take internet-facing instances offline or restrict access to CKEditor endpoints. Within 7 days: Upgrade all BraveCMS installations to version 2.0.6 or later per vendor release on GitHub. …
